mws72 said:
I finally got around to tapping one of my BC796Ds. The tap at LND12 worked fine feeding a dataslicer with trunker. But when I tried unitrunker with the sound card it didn't. Any ideas anyone?

Additonal info: It would run when I used a BC-245XLT as the source.
Check these two things - signal level and signal polarity. Different models of radios will have different signal levels. One might be 2 volts peak-to-peak while another is 0.6 volts. A weak signal will be too flat to have a recognizable waveform. An overly strong signal will be clipped also preventing accurate decoding.

Check the signal level with any of a number of free software oscilloscope programs. Your computer's sound input may have a gain adjustment which you can use to get a useable signal level.

If the signal level looks good - check the signal polarity. Try turning "Signal Invert" ON or OFF in the program. Your decode rate might suddently jump from zero to 100%.
